Information provided with us :
- 7th term of the A.P. is 14.
- 12th term of the A.P. is 24.
What we have to calculate :
- First term (a) and common difference (d) of the A.P.?
Performing Calculations :
Now, as we clearly know that nth or general term of an A.P. (Arithmetic progression) is calculated by the formula :
Here in this formula,
- a denotes first term
- d is common difference
- tn is number of terms
For 7th term of the A.P. :
=> 14 = a + (7 - 1) d
=> 14 = a + 6d
=> a = 14 - 6d
For 12th term of the A.P. :
=> 24 = a + (12 - 1) d
=> 24 = a + 11 × d
=> 24 = a + 11d
Substitute the value of a which we got above,
=> 24 = 14 - 6d + 11d
=> 24 = 14 + 5d
=> 5d = 24 - 14
=> 5d = 10
=> d = 2
★ Therefore, common difference is 2..!!
Finding out first term (a) of the A.P. :
=> a = 14 - 6d
=> a = 14 - 6 (2)
=> a = 14 - 6 × 2
=> a = 14 - 12
=> a = 2
★ Therefore, first term of the A.P. is 2..!!
